Mitsubishi UFJ Asset Management Co. Ltd. lifted its stake in Intuitive Surgical, Inc. (NASDAQ:ISRG – Free Report) by 4.8% in the third qu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 857,315 shares of the medical equipment provider’s stock after purchasing an additional 39,433 shares during the quarter. Mitsubishi UFJ Asset Management Co. Ltd.’s holdings in Intuitive Surgical were worth $383,417,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

Insider Buying and Selling
In other news, Director Gary S. Guthart sold 24,500 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ction on Tuesday, January 27th. The shares were sold at an average price of $530.10, for a total value of $12,987,450.00. Following the completion of the sale, the director directly owned 3,694 shares in the company, valued at approximately $1,958,189.40. The trade was a 86.90% decrease in their ownership of the stock. Intuitive Surgical Price Performance
Intuitive Surgical (NASDAQ:ISRG –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, January 22nd. The medical equipment provider reported $2.53 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$2.27 by $0.26. Intuitive Surgical had a return on equity of 15.06% and a net margin of 28.38%.The company had revenue of $2.87 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$2.72 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company posted $2.21 EPS. The firm’s revenue was up 18.8% on a year-over-year basis. On average, equities analysts expect that Intuitive Surgical, Inc. will post 6.43 EPS for the current year.

About Intuitive Surgical
Intuitive Surgical, founded in 1995 and headquartered in Sunnyvale, California, is a medical technology company focused on the design, manufacture and service of robotic-assisted surgical systems. The company is best known for its da Vinci surgical systems, which enable minimally invasive procedures by translating a surgeon’s hand movements into finer, scaled motions of small instruments inside the patient. Intuitive’s business centers on supplying hospitals and surgical centers with systems, instruments and related technologies that aim to improve precision, visualization and control in the operating room.
In addition to its core surgical platforms, Intuitive markets a portfolio of reusable and disposable instruments, accessories, and proprietary software, and provides training, servicing and clinical support to its customers.
